Add support for SN5640 and SN5610 Nvidia switch.
SN5640 is a 51.2Tbps switch based on Nvidia SPC-5 ASIC.
It provides up-to 400Gbps full bidirectional bandwidth per port.
The system supports 64 OSFP cages and fits into standard 2U racks.
SN5640 Features:
- 64 OSFP ports supporting 2.5Gbps - 400Gbps speeds.
- Air-cooled with 4 + 1 redundant fan units.
- 2 + 2 redundant 2000W PSUs.
- System management board based on AMD CPU with secure-boot support.
SN5610 is a 51.2Tbps switch based on Nvidia SPC-4 ASIC.
It provides up-to 800Gbps full bidirectional bandwidth per port.
The system supports 64 OSFP cages and fits into standard 2U racks.
SN5610 Features:
- 64 OSFP ports supporting 10Gbps - 800Gbps speeds.
- Air-cooled with 4 + 1 redundant fan units.
- 2 + 2 redundant 2000W PSUs.
- System management board based on AMD CPU with secure-boot support.
